

Gloria Ann Garza Alderete went to be with our Lord and Savior on 17 August 2016. She was born in San Antonio, Texas on 8 June 1954 to Tomas and Frances Garza. She was preceded in death by her parents and brother Edward Garza. She is survived by brother Adam Garza, her loving husband of 45 years Lawrence A. Alderete, son Lawrence A. Alderete Jr., daughter Alisa Leon, grandsons Michael, Augie, Gabriel and Esper, granddaughters Passion, Desiree and Bianca, great granddaughters Emry and Abi.
On 6 February 1971 she married Lawrence A. Alderete and they remained inseparable . They traveled extensively throughout the United States as she provided uncompromising support to her husband during 22 years of service in the United States Marine Corps. She was a dedicated United States Marine Corps wife (TOUGHEST JOB IN THE CORPS), nurturing mother and a friend to anyone she encountered. She saw her greatest accomplishments in her children, grandchildren and great grandchildren.
The family would like to extend a loving thanks and appreciation to the doctors and staff of San Antonio Military Medical Center (SAMMC) in San Antonio, Texas, Warm Springs Rehabilitation Center Thousand Oaks in San Antonio, Texas and Warm Springs Long Term Acute Care Facility in New Braunfels, Texas. Your exceptional collective efforts granted her additional time on this earth to prepare for her journey into eternity.
GLORIA WILL BE MISSED !
Visitation will take place from 6 PM to 8 PM on Tuesday, 23 August 2016 at Sunset Funeral Home. Funeral service will be held at 9AM at Sunset Funeral Home Chapel with interment to follow at Fort Sam Houston National Cemetery.
